Nancy,

	False choices :-)  

	The Kindle & Nook read proprietary formats.  If/when
these products
are discontinued or their estores die, you may lose access
to your books.

	Amazon has already proven that they can
REVOKE/Delete books you
bought, without refunding, at any time.

	Get an iPad instead.  You can buy a $ 5 program that
lets you read
ebooks on the iPad.  We use it to read thousands of free &
purchased ebooks.

	I refuse to buy digital books or music that vendors
can revoke or
hijack at whim.  If I paid for it, it's mine.  Just like
real books...or
cds.

	As strange as it sounds, the iPad is the most
consumer-friendly
ebook reader precisely because you can buy an app that reads
the EPUB format
(there are free softwares for Mac & PC that lets you convert
HTML, Word,
PDF, etc into EPub)

- Raj
